With Mother's Day approaching, I thought it would be inspiring to feature one of your stories about the exceptional women in your life. Today's testimony is Dara's Legacy, a story of thanksgiving for the godly women in Dara's life. Each one has passed down a legacy of holy living and genuine faith in God. Dara's prayer is to follow in their footsteps and leave a legacy of godliness that will eternally influence the lives of her own children and grandchildren.
